Inning summaries and stats are brought to you once again by Astro


LSU Pitching
Jared Poché 6.0 IP, 4 H, 0 R, 0 BB, 3 K
Cody Glenn 1.0 IP, 0 H, 0 R, 0 BB, 0 K

Grambling Pitching
Brock Baker 5.1 IP, 7 H, 5 R, 4 ER, 3 BB, 1 HBP, 1 K (89 pitches)
Michael Martin 1.1 IP, 2 H, 1 R, 1 ER, 1 BB, 0 K
David Allen 0.1 IP, 0 H, 0 R, 0 BB, 0 K

Grambling Lineup:
Drexler 0 for 3
Minter 1 for 3, K, CS
Bueno 0 for 3
Timeo 0 for 3
Medina 0 for 3
Kiser 1 for 3, K
Hall 0 for 2, K
Diaz 1 for 2, 2B
Holbrook 1 for 2, SB


LSU Lineup:
Andrew Stevenson 3 for 3, BB, RBI
Chris Sciambra 1 for 3, SF, RBI
Alex Bregman 1 for 3, SF, RBI
Chris Chinea 1 for 4, HR, RBI, R
Danny Zardon 1 for 4, K
Jared Foster 0 for 4
Kade Scivicque 2 for 4, R
Dakota Dean 0 for 3, BB, R
Kramer Robertson 0 for 0, 2 BB, HBP, 3 R


Top 1
Drexler grounded out to the pitcher (1 out)
Minter grounded out to 2nd (2 outs)
Bueno grounded out to short (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 0-0 after a half inning

Bot 1
Stevenson singled up the middle
Sciambra singled to left, Stevenson to 2nd
Bregman grounded out to the pitcher, Stevenson to 3rd, Sciambra to 2nd (1 out)
Chinea lined out to 2nd, runners hold (2 outs)
Zardon struck out swinging (3 outs)
0 R, 2 H, 0 E, 2 LOB; 0-0 after 1

Top 2
Timeo reached on a fielding error by the 1st baseman
Medina grounded into a 6-3 double play, Timeo out at 2nd (2 outs)
Kiser singled on the infield to the 3rd baseman
Hall struck out swinging (3 outs)
0 R, 1 H, 1 E, 1 LOB; 0-0 after 1.5

Bot 2
Foster grounded out to 3rd (1 out)
Scivicque singled to left
Dean flied out right (2 outs)
Robertson walked, Scivicque to 2nd
Stevenson RBI single to right, Scivicque scored, Robertson to 3rd; 1-0 Tigers
Stevenson stole 2nd, Robertson stole home; 2-0 Tigers
Sciambra flied out to right (3 outs)
2 R, 2 H, 0 E, 1 LOB; 2-0 LSU after 2

Top 3
Diaz grounded out to the pitcher (1 out)
Holbrook popped out foul to 2nd (2 outs)
Drexler grounded out to 1st unassisted (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 2-0 LSU after 2.5

Bot 3
Bregman singled to left
Chinea grounded into a fielder's choice to short, Bregman out at 2nd (1 out)
Zardon popped out to 1st (2 outs)
Foster grounded to 2nd, flip to 2nd is not covered by the shortstop, runners are safe, E4
Scivicque grounded to 3rd, fielder's choice, Chinea out at 3rd (3 outs)
0 R, 1 H, 1 E, 3 LOB; 2-0 LSU after 3

Top 4
Minter singled up the middle
Bueno flied out to right (1 out)
With an 0-0 count on Timeo, Minter caught stealing 2nd (2 outs)
Timeo flied out to right (3 outs)
0 R, 1 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 2-0 LSU after 3.5

Bot 4
Dean walked
Robertson hit by the pitch, Dean to 2nd
Stevenson bunt single to 3rd, Dean to 3rd, Robertson to 2nd
Sciambra sacrifice flied to right, Dean scored, Robertson to 3rd; 3-0 Tigers (1 out)
Bregman sacrifice flied out foul to right, Robertson scored, Stevenson holds 1st; 4-0 LSU (2 outs)
Chinea flied out to center (3 outs)
2 R, 1 H, 0 E, 1 LOB; 4-0 LSU after 4

Top 5
Medina grounded out to short (1 out)
Kiser struck out swinging (2 outs)
Hall grounded out to short (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; Halfway home at The Box, LSU leads 4-0

Bot 5
Zardon singled to right
Foster flied out to center (1 out)
Scivicque grounded into a 6-4-3 double play, Zardon out at 2nd (3 outs)
0 R, 1 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 4-0 LSU after 5

Top 6
Diaz doubled to left
Holbrook singled to center, Diaz to 3rd
Drexler lined out to 2nd, runners hold (1 out)
Minter struck out swinging (2 outs)
Holbrook stole 2nd, Diaz holds 3rd
Bueno grounded out to 2nd (3 outs)
0 R, 2 H, 0 E, 2 LOB; 4-0 LSU after 5.5

Bot 6
Dean grounded out to 1st (1 out)
Robertson walked
Grambling pitching change from Brock Baker to Michael Martin
With Stevenson batting, Robertson advanced to 2nd on a 0-0 wild pitch
Stevenson walked, Robertson holds 2nd
Sciambra flied out to center, runners hold (2 outs)
With Bregman batting, an errant pick off attempt by the catcher goes into right field, Robertson scored, Stevenson to 2nd; 5-0 LSU
Bregman flied out to center (3 outs)
1 R, 0 H, 1 E, 2 LOB; 4-0 LSU after 6

Top 7
Timeo flied out to right (1 out)
Medina grounded out to the pitcher (2 outs)
Kiser grounded out to 2nd (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 5-0 LSU at the stretch

Bot 7
Chinea homered to left; 6-0 LSU
Zardon popped out foul to 3rd (1 out)
Foster grounded out to short (2 outs)
Scivicque singled to center
Grambling pitching change from Michael Martin to David Allen
Dean flied out to left (3 outs)
1 R, 2 H, 0 E, 1 LOB; 6-0 LSU after 7
